Exploited: Filipino Workers in Geneva

Exploited: Filipino Workers in Geneva

Across Geneva, Switzerland, tens of thousands of undocumented Filipino workers cook meals, clean homes and care for wealthy families.

But their own accommodation is a daily struggle.

At the mercy of so-called “slumlords”, they are forced to pay exorbitant rates in a sordid trade in which apartments are rented out by the room. More than 10 people are often crammed in a small one-bedroom flat.

101 East exposes the exploitation of vulnerable Filipino workers in one of the richest countries in the world.
